general info of LSPPP:

LSppp is a small osDOS PPP packet driver.
It is compatible with the needs of WATTCP.
LSppp loads as a class one ethernet driver and handles all
aspects of the connection from dialing onward.


lspppacm, this project fork LSPPP for working with USB-devices
(device must correspond to "Communications Device Class" and
"Abstract Control Model" definitions )

This was checked on three devices:

  1. usb serial adapter GMUS-03
    + data-cable DCA-500
    + mobilephone Siemens AX75 :-)
  2. mobilephone Nokia-5130
  3. CDMA-modem AnyData ADU-310A


tested by IP-stacks:

  1. wattcp16 & wattcp32
    • Arachne 1.95, Lynx 2.8.5, wget 1.8.2, DOS-ftp 1.1
  2. Trumpet IP-stack, NTCPDRV.EXE ver.3.1 1992 :-)
    • ping, mail client CHASE 1.0 from RubberMallet.org
  3. utility from http://www.brutman.com/mTCP/
    • ping, ftp client, ver. 2011-01-02
  4. jnos ver. 2.0f (only ping)
  5. Datalight ROM-DOS TCP/IP Sockets (RINET TCP/IP of http://www.gpvno.co.za)
    • ping, ftp client
